> In DW, if you're in page design mode and you don't have the file  
> maximized, you can set the window size using the drop down at the  
> bottom right edge of the design pane.  Right above where the  
> properties tab is.
> 
> On Dec 10, 2008, at 6:02 PM, Matthew Smith wrote:
> 
> > I am currently on a 22" widescreen monitor.  I would like to be able  
> > to see how the pages I am developing will look on a standard  
> > resolution monitor, running say 1024x768.  I seem to remember  
> > something in Dreamweaver that opened a preview browser with the  
> > dimensions of the window set to different resolution sizes.  I can't  
> > find it now.  Is there something in dreamweaver that I'm missing?   
> > Is there another way to do this?  Maybe a browser shortcut that sets  
> > the window size properly?
